Iraqi lawmakers shy away from electing new president
Iraqi lawmakers failed again on Saturday to elect a new president for the country due to a lack of quorum...Parliament had issued a final list of 40 candidates for the post, a largely ceremonial role that by convention is reserved for a member of Iraq's Kurdish minority
The postponement exacerbates Iraq's political problems because it is the task of the president to formally name a prime minister

Palestinians turn out to vote in West Bank municipal polls
Polls opened Saturday in towns and cities in the Israeli-occupied West Bank in a rare democratic exercise following a decade...It is the second phase of municipal elections after a first round of voting in December in 154 West Bank villages
No legislative or presidential elections have been held in the Palestinian territories for 15 years, following repeated delays

Iraq once more into presidential vote unknown
Saturday's session risks underscoring the sharp divide in Iraqi politics between Sadr and the powerful Coordination Framework that includes the...Iraqi Parliament has to choose between Barham Saleh from the Patriotic Union of Kurdistan and Rebar Ahmed of the Kurdistan Democratic Party for the new president
Sadr, the general election's big winner wants to make his cousin Jaafar Sadr the Prime Minister of Iraq with the support of Sunni and Kurdish parties
